Túxpam de Rodríguez Cano weather in February

In February, Túxpam de Rodríguez Cano sees average daytime highs of 25°C and overnight lows near 18°C, with 31 mm of rain across 6.7 wet days and about 11.3 hours of daylight. It is the 10th-warmest and 12th-wettest month of the year here.

Highs climb over the month, from about 24°C in the first days to 26°C by the end.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 23% of the time in February, and the air most often feels muggy.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 06 min at the start of February to 11 h 30 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, February is Túxpam de Rodríguez Cano's 9th-clearest and 5th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Túxpam de Rodríguez Cano's year-round climate.

Location & terrain

Where is Túxpam de Rodríguez Cano?

Túxpam de Rodríguez Cano sits at 21.0°N, 97.4°W, 11 m above sea level, in Mexico. The nearest listed city is Alto Lucero, 4.0 km away.

Topography around Túxpam de Rodríguez Cano

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Túxpam de Rodríguez Cano.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Túxpam de Rodríguez Cano has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 44 m around an average of 10 m above sea level; within 16 km,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 159 m; within 80 km,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,295 m.

The land around Túxpam de Rodríguez Cano is covered by trees (38%), artificial surfaces (33%) and grassland (22%) within 3 km, grassland (45%) and trees (28%) within 16 km, and trees (36%), grassland (31%) and water (31%) within 80 km.
